Khattak announces district comprising Palas and Kolai
peshawar — Khyber Pakhtunkhwa Chief Minister Pervaiz Khattak on Saturday announced a permanent district comprising Kolai and Palas sub-divisions and said the people of Kohistan should forge unity as it would bring prosperity and development to the area.
Addressing a representative jirga of Kohistan, he urged the area people to shun differences and promote understanding and reconciliation for their own benefit. He said the people of Kohistan should focus their energies to exploit resources of their area and change their socio-economic conditions.
The chief minister said that unity among people of Kohistan was his utmost desire and the announcement for third district was made as it was the best available option to remove differences among the people of Kohistan according to their wishes and aspirations.
He said the new district was necessary for the development of the area as differences were creating hurdles in the development process. He said the move would give impetus to the ongoing development work in Kohistan.
Pervaiz Khattak deplored performance of the previous government and said that countless accomplishments had been achieved by the provincial government which took numerous steps for the development of province, including promotion of education and laws against usury and corruption.
The chief minister said the province was on course to progress and confidence of investors was strengthening, adding the government would hold a road show in china soon to attract foreign investment.
He said the government would add 4000MW of electricity in the system before the end of its tenure that would create jobs through rapid industrialisation, thereby eliminating poverty.
He claimed that the ruling Pakistan Tehreek-e-Insaaf would again come to power owing to its performance and record development work. — APP
